<p>From Nancy Redfeather:<br />
I hope you’ve all had a chance to visit The Kohala Center&#8217;s Web site for the <a href="http://www.kohalacenter.org/seedsymposium/about.html">&#8220;Hua Ka Hua &#8211; Restore Our Seed&#8221; Symposium </a>in Kona on April 16-18, 2010, at www.kohalacenter.org/seedsymposium/about.html.</p>
<p>The deadline to take advantage of the early registration discounted price is March 15. Before March 15, the registration fee is $100 for both days. After March 15, the cost goes up to $150. Spaces are limited, so register early to secure your spot at the Symposium. The Keauhou Beach Resort is offering a special rate for conference accommodations of $122.53 per night (including tax) for a single/double room with a partial ocean view and a daily buffet breakfast.</p>
<p>The Symposium will also feature a Seed Swap hosted by Regeneration Botanicals on Saturday, April 17, following the last session of the day. Information tables will be available in the foyer for a nominal fee, for conference participants who wish to share programs and information with the public.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.kohalacenter.org/seedsymposium/about.html">This Symposium</a> is an excellent opportunity to come together, expand our basic knowledge, connect with experts and resources, create island-wide working groups, and get our farmers and gardeners growing, selecting, processing, using, trading, and selling high quality seed. Seed is the foundation of a thriving local agricultural economy and food abundance. Please join us for this landmark event and let&#8217;s take charge of our agricultural future.</p>
